    Day 1 0:00 Pandan bread
    Day 2 1:30 PB&J with cheese
    Day 3 2:50 Fairy bread
    Day 4 4:04 Kallihim (a secret)
    Day 5 6:12 Bread with Hagelslag (chocolate sprinkles)
    Day 6 7:11 Squid ink bread (failed)
    Day 7 8:12 Hotteok with corn and cheese filling (korean pancake)
    Day 8 10:22 Strawberry sando (sandwich)
    Day 6 redo 12:12 Squid ink bread (complete)
    Day 9 14:22 Fluffernutter sandwich (marshmallow fluff, PB, bacon)
    Day 10 15:22 Canned bread ( Oatmeal raisin flavor)
    Day 11 16:53 Flat bread
    Day 12 17:53 Pita bread
    Day 13 19:45 Savory french toast with Pandan from Day 1
    Day 14 20:56 Orange soda bread (failed)
    Day 14 redo 22:20 Orange soda bread (complete)
    Day 15 23:37 Ensaymada (egg and butter dough with cinnamon butter whipped topping and cheese
    Day 16 25:25 Pizza waffle
    Day 17 27:12 Bread pudding with Pandan from Day 1, Coconut strips and Jackfruit strips
    Day 18 28:29 Brownie bread
    Day 19 30:01 Cinnamon roll with chili (featuring Lisa Nguyen!)
    Day 20 32:38 Conchas (soft bread with a designed, crumbly topping)
    Day 21 35:12 Brazillian cheese bread
    Day 22 36:24 Banana bread with yellow jackfruit and walnuts
    Day 23 37:50 Pull-apart bread with crab rangoon filling and fried wonton rapper topping
    Day 24 39:53 Mount Fugi bread from Yakatake Japan
    Day 25 43:12 Monkey bread
    Day 26 44:56 Shibouya honey toast
    Day 27 46:44 Surprise-filled donuts with salted duck egg yolk custard filling
    Day 28 49:05 Foccacia (Italian bread with alot nof olive oil and often poked with one's fingers!)
    Day 29 50:37 Hunger games inspired bread (Peeta gives Katniss bread) with rasins, seeds, and nuts
    Day 30 52:21 Breakfast, Lunch/Dinner and Dessert pizza
